Lucien Morey
fa66ed866c
add file marker for type checking ( #1598 )
...
I think this is the correct way to do this based on my understanding of
the guide to making a [pep561 compliant
package](https://mypy.readthedocs.io/en/stable/installed_packages.html#creating-pep-561-compatible-packages )
and this example in
[black](https://github.com/psf/black/pull/1395/files ). Given that I get
all the type-checking info from a local installation, I don't know if
this is testable until it's published on Pypi.
resolves #1210
2024-11-21 04:43:05 +00:00
Lucien Morey
097e641789
[Python] remove opencv dependency for robot installations ( #1580 )
2024-11-16 18:26:07 -08:00
Lucien Morey
a7319ce1d6
[photonlibpy] bump python dependencies for 2025 ( #1567 )
...
I tasked my team with updating our upcoming Reefscape codebase to target
2025 packages, only to realise we have created an unsolvable dependency
nightmare with these things being neglected...
2024-11-13 10:38:44 -05:00
Lucien Morey
b3d74e56a0
Add python simulation ( #1532 )
2024-11-10 14:16:02 -08:00
Jade
d8de4a7863
[build] Update wpiformat to 2024.45 ( #1545 )
...
Signed-off-by: Jade Turner <spacey-sooty@proton.me >
2024-11-10 13:42:16 +08:00
Matt
169595e56e
Auto-generate packet dataclasses with Jinja ( #1374 )
2024-08-31 13:44:19 -04:00
Ethan Wall
90773e0e4a
[photonlib-py] Begin implementing PhotonPoseEstimator in Python ( #1178 )
...
* [photonlib-py] Initial impl of PhotonPoseEstimator
---------
Co-authored-by: Matt <matthew.morley.ca@gmail.com >
2024-01-21 06:57:32 -06:00
Matt
0cec1eef9f
[python] Only add maturity/suffix to version if groups matched ( #1146 )
...
* Only add maturity/suffix if groups matched
---------
Co-authored-by: Chris Gerth <gerth2@users.noreply.github.com >
2024-01-10 23:23:40 -06:00
Chris Gerth
276fc6178e
Apparently we need to get better about longDescription? ( #1117 )
...
Maybe make pypi happy(ier)
2024-01-05 18:03:55 -05:00
Chris Gerth
47aea29b6b
Add photonlibpy ( #1040 )
...
* Added a pure-python implementation of photonlib, named photonlibpy and hosted on pypi
---------
Co-authored-by: Matt <matthew.morley.ca@gmail.com >
2023-12-16 12:32:49 -06:00